diff options
author | Christoph Hellwig <hch@lst.de> | 2018-05-31 19:11:40 +0200 |
---|---|---|
committer | Jens Axboe <axboe@kernel.dk> | 2018-06-01 07:38:21 -0600 |
commit | 131d08e122eaabae028378c0b4da688eb044c6af (patch) | |
tree | 1c48c6886d4e90d543fe738ba4c426531dcd637b /block/blk-mq.c | |
parent | acddf3b308f6b6e23653de02e1abf98f402f1f12 (diff) | |
download | lwn-131d08e122eaabae028378c0b4da688eb044c6af.tar.gz lwn-131d08e122eaabae028378c0b4da688eb044c6af.zip |
block: split the blk-mq case from elevator_init
There is almost no shared logic, which leads to a very confusing code
flow.
Signed-off-by: Christoph Hellwig <hch@lst.de>
Reviewed-by: Damien Le Moal <damien.lemoal@wdc.com>
Tested-by: Damien Le Moal <damien.lemoal@wdc.com>
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'block/blk-mq.c')
-rw-r--r-- | block/blk-mq.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/block/blk-mq.c b/block/blk-mq.c index 858d6edff4d3..6332940ca118 100644 --- a/block/blk-mq.c +++ b/block/blk-mq.c @@ -2573,7 +2573,7 @@ struct request_queue *blk_mq_init_allocated_queue(struct blk_mq_tag_set *set, if (!(set->flags & BLK_MQ_F_NO_SCHED)) { int ret; - ret = elevator_init(q); + ret = elevator_init_mq(q); if (ret) return ERR_PTR(ret); } |